Duties as a Paint Sprayer will include:
  • Preparing and applying paint to vehicles in accordance with manufacturer specifications and quality standards
  • Ensuring a flawless finish by mixing and colour matching paints accurately
  • Inspecting vehicles prior to painting and assessing repair requirements
  • Maintaining a clean and organised work environment to meet health and safety standards
  • Collaborating with team members and customers to keep them informed on progress
  • Ensuring all work adheres to safety and quality regulations
Requirements for this Paint Sprayer position:
  • Proven experience as a Paint Sprayer, with a solid understanding of vehicle painting processes
  • NVQ Level 3 or equivalent qualification in Vehicle Painting and Refinishing
  • Attention to detail and a high standard of workmanship
  • Ability to work efficiently both independently and within a team environment
  • Full UK driving licence preferred
